Stunning Views at Glenfinnan
We are looking forward to going back to the Glenfinnan House Hotel next year for more marquee weddings. The award winning Glenfinnan House Hotel is located on the shores of Loch Shiel and is close to the famous Glenfinnan monument, at 18 metres high it is a poignant monument to the final Jacobite Rising. The marquee shown was a 9m x 27m marquee was from a wedding earlier on this year – what a view!
